| # OncoVision-X: Lung Cancer Detection System | |
| AI-powered lung cancer detection system using Dual-Context Attention Networks (DCA-Net). | |
| ## Overview | |
| This application analyzes CT scans to detect and classify lung nodules, providing clinical risk assessments and visualizations. | |

| ## Model Architecture | |
| Developed by the OncoVision team, utilizing: | |
| - **Nodule Analysis Stream**: EfficientNet-B0 with cross-slice attention. | |
| - **Context Analysis Stream**: 3D CNN for surrounding anatomy. | |
| - **Fusion**: Multi-head attention for final prediction. | |
